Divorce Documents in Karachi: What Each Route Is For

Matter / DocumentCore RecordPrimary Purpose
TalaqnamaRecords the Talaq declaration and marriage particularsHusband-initiated Talaq
Divorce DeedFormal record of the divorce declaration and suitable connected termsTalaq / documented settlement context
Statutory Talaq NoticeWritten notice to the competent Chairman with wife copySection 7 Muslim Talaq procedure
Khula PapersFamily Court plaint and supporting documentsWife seeking judicial dissolution
Divorce Registration CertificateOfficial post-procedure local-authority recordLater administrative / foreign use

Legal framework

Family & Divorce Law Framework Relevant to Karachi

Common matrimonial and child-related work is governed by the legal route actually involved. The Family Courts Act, 1964 covers matters including dissolution of marriage/Khula, dower, maintenance, custody/visitation, guardianship and dowry within its schedule. The Guardians and Wards Act, 1890 remains important for guardianship proceedings.

For husband-initiated Muslim Talaq, section 7 of the Muslim Family Laws Ordinance, 1961 requires written notice to the competent Chairman and a copy to the wife. Talaq ordinarily does not become effective until ninety days from delivery of that notice, unless revoked earlier, subject to the statutory pregnancy provision.

Forum, service and local filing mechanics can vary with jurisdiction and facts, so a generic online form should not be treated as a substitute for case-specific legal review.

Divorce Papers, Divorce Deed & Talaqnama in Karachi: Common Questions

What are divorce papers in Karachi?

Divorce papers can include a Talaqnama, Divorce Deed, statutory notice, Nikah Nama, identity documents, Khula or dissolution pleadings, court decree and an official divorce registration record.

Is a Talaqnama the same as a Divorce Deed in Karachi?

The terms are often used loosely in practice. What matters is what the document records and whether the required statutory or court procedure is also completed.

Is a Divorce Deed the same as a divorce certificate in Karachi?

No. A Divorce Deed records the declaration or terms; a divorce registration certificate is an official post-procedure record.

Can I use a downloaded Talaqnama template in Karachi?

A template may not match the Nikah Nama, identities, dower terms, addresses, jurisdiction or legal route.

What should a Talaqnama contain in Karachi?

It should accurately identify the parties, marriage particulars, addresses, date of pronouncement and nature of the declaration without contradictory dates or terms.

What are Khula papers in Karachi?

Khula papers generally include the Family Court plaint, marriage record, identity documents, husband's particulars/address, dower information and supporting documents.

Can divorce papers be prepared for an overseas Pakistani in Karachi?

Yes. Drafting and review can often be handled remotely, but execution, attestation, jurisdiction and service requirements should be checked.

What records should be kept after divorce in Karachi?

Keep the Talaqnama or Divorce Deed, notices, filing/service proof, Nikah Nama copy, court decree where applicable, official divorce registration certificate and certified copies.
